MINUTES OF THE <br /> ORONO PLANNING COMMISSION MEETING <br /> Monday,July 21,2014 <br /> 6:30 o'clock p.m. <br /> Mack stated the residents on Baldur Park Road also submitted a petition to the City Council asking them <br /> to consider reconstructing the roadway. <br /> Schoenzeit stated he attended the July 14 meeting. There was a presentation on the large area of Baldur <br /> Park Road was flooded and what portions of the road are below 932.5. In addition, Dennis Walsh spoke <br /> about the police addition and the cost overruns as well as the lack of enforcement of City Codes. The <br /> Orono Public Schools application was approved as well as the Northern Avenue application. A <br /> discussion was held regarding the large number of trees that were being removed as part of that <br /> development from what was originally proposed and as a result the City Council requested the applicant <br /> submit a new landscaping plan. <br /> Schoenzeit stated the vacation of the easement for Wolverton Place was approved, with a lengthy <br /> discussion on the amount of fee reimbursement. The City Council also requested the encroachment <br /> agreement for Joseph Church be more specific on the items encroaching on the fire lane. <br /> Gaffron stated the Lakeview application will be before the City Council on June 28. Gaffron indicated <br /> the revised sketch plan will likely show 2-acre lots, no public trail, and 47 units. <br /> 8. OTHER ISSUES FOR DISCUSSION <br /> Mack noted last week he presented a webinar overview of all of the code changes in the Minnesota 2014 <br /> legislative session that have anything to do with planning/zoning/annexation laws, etc. Mack stated there <br /> is a case coming out of Bloomington that will be before the Minnesota Supreme Court dealing with <br /> conditional use permits and the ability for a City to deny a conditional use permit. Mack indicated he <br /> would send out a link to the webinar to the Planning Commission if they are interested in reviewing that. <br /> ADJOURNMENT <br /> Leskinen moved, Schoenzeit seconded,to adjourn the Orono Planning Commission meeting at 9:37 <br /> p.m. VOTE: Ayes 7,Nays 0. <br /> ATTEST: <br /> ls-led'e <br /> Denise Leskinen, Chair <br /> Page 30 of 30 <br />
